Full Job Description
What Is The Opportunity?

Reporting to the Finance Director, the Finance Manager will be responsible for the financial and administration including reporting, budgeting, forecasting and day-to-day transactions to ensure that the financial objectives are met and accounting procedures are carried out.

Aecon Civil is a recognized leader in the market, backed by strong self-perform capabilities and deep local expertise. We play a key role in building and enhancing infrastructure across Canada, the U.S., and an expanding international footprint improving everyday life through the roads, bridges, tunnels, and transit systems that connect communities. With more than a century of experience and a full suite of integrated services, Aecon is a trusted partner for delivering complex civil projects, including tunnels, transit expansions, airports, ports, highways, and large-scale site development.

What You'll Do Here:
  • Oversight of finance activities within a business unit or functional area, this could include financial reporting, budgeting, taxation.
  • Coordinate the close off process and prepare monthly consolidated financial statements and related schedules & notes.
  • Consolidation of joint arrangements for financial statement preparation.
  • Work effectively with, influence and support projects teams, joint arrangements & JV Partners.
  • Implement & manage internal control procedures.
  • Coordinate & manage internal and external audits.
  • Develop annual budgets and quarterly forecasts in concert with the respective business partners.
  • Investigate / analyze departmental variances from budgets/forecast on a monthly/quarterly basis - working closely with business partners.
  • Involved in supporting accounting research to provide recommendations, ensuring the Company complies with all areas of IFRS and in accordance with established Aecon policies and procedures.
  • Enhance the applicable finance processes and support process improvement initiatives to achieve financial goals and improve efficiency and profitability.
  • Mentor and develop finance team.
  • Build a strong network across various teams to handle a wide range of analytical and operational issues.
  • Support preparation of financial presentations & analyses for the leadership team.
  • Support preparation of ad-hoc financial analyses (including "what-if" scenario analysis) as required to support business partners.
